I've been crocheting since I was about 10. I learned when my aunt had leukemia and lost all her hair but didn't want to wear wigs - so I made her lots of hats. Over the years I've made blankets, scarves and hats but just recently decided to try some gloves. Here are two colors of fingerless gloves that I made.
Also, I got a succulent plant called String of Tears that needed to be hung, so I crocheted a plant hanger for it:

A slideshow that shows the postcards in their various stages of being made.
Basically, I:
-taped the cards together
-drew the image
-outlined with a Sharpie
-Painted
-re-outlined
-separated the cards
-addressed and wrote out messages
-glued sequins
-glued beads
-glued glitter
-taped over
-sent
It took longer than I thought it might and my body ached in some weird ways from all the sitting, standing, kneeling, etc. but it was fun.

My cousins kids likes to do "play shopping seller". So... for their birthday in April, we bought them that shopping cart. The broom is for the boy, as he likes to clean, and we're breaking stereotypes or something.
Anyways, my sister had another idea: We should make them aprons to kind of go with the cleaning/shopping seller theme. She picked the fabric out, and I sewed them. It is an elastic neck strap and a velcro around-the-back attachment thingie so they can easily put it on themselves. They aren't perfect, but I think they turned out pretty darn well. My father sure liked to laugh at me given that I know how to sew though. >.>
Yep. My weekend project.
